Directions
- Preheat your oven to 375ยฐF (190ยฐC).
- Cook the gnocchi according to package instructions, then drain and set aside.
- In a large skillet, melt butter over medium heat and sautรฉ garlic until fragrant.
- Sprinkle in the flour and whisk continuously to create a roux.
- Slowly pour in the broth and heavy cream, whisking until smooth.
- Add Parmesan cheese, salt, pepper, and Italian seasoning, stirring until the sauce thickens.
- Mix in the cooked gnocchi and transfer to a greased baking dish.
- Sprinkle mozzarella cheese over the top and bake for 15-20 minutes or until golden and bubbly.
- Remove from the oven and let sit for a few minutes before garnishing with fresh parsley.
- Serve warm and enjoy!

Storage/Reheating
- Storage: Store leftovers in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days.
- Reheating: Warm in the microwave in 30-second intervals, stirring occasionally. Alternatively, reheat in the oven at 350ยฐF (175ยฐC) for about 10 minutes, covered with foil to prevent drying.
FAQs
How do I prevent the sauce from becoming too thick?
If the sauce thickens too much, add a splash of broth or milk to loosen it before baking.
Can I use store-bought gnocchi?
Yes! Pre-packaged gnocchi works perfectly and saves time.
Can I make this dish ahead of time?
Absolutely! Assemble the dish, cover, and refrigerate for up to 24 hours before baking.
What can I serve with creamy baked gnocchi?
A simple side salad or garlic bread complements the dish well.
Can I freeze baked gnocchi?
Itโs best enjoyed fresh, but you can freeze it before baking. Thaw overnight in the fridge before baking as directed.
How do I make it gluten-free?
Use gluten-free gnocchi and substitute the flour with a gluten-free alternative.
Can I use milk instead of heavy cream?
Yes, but the sauce will be thinner. For best results, use whole milk with a little extra cheese.
Why is my gnocchi mushy?
Overcooked gnocchi can become too soft. Cook it just until it floats, then drain immediately.
What other herbs can I use?
Try basil, thyme, or oregano for added flavor depth.
Can I add a crispy topping?
Yes! Sprinkle breadcrumbs mixed with melted butter and Parmesan before baking for a crunchy topping.

Ingredients
- 1 lb (16 oz) potato gnocchi
- 1 tbsp olive oil
- 2 tbsp unsalted butter
- 3 cloves garlic, minced
- 1 cup heavy cream
- 1 cup whole milk
- 1 cup shredded mozzarella cheese
- 1/2 cup grated Parmesan cheese
- 1/2 tsp salt
- 1/2 tsp black pepper
- 1/2 tsp Italian seasoning
- 1/4 tsp red pepper flakes (optional)
- 1/2 cup cooked and crumbled bacon (optional)
- 1/2 cup fresh spinach, chopped (optional)
- 1/4 cup fresh basil, chopped (for garnish)
Instructions
- Preheat the ovenย to 375ยฐF (190ยฐC). Grease a 9×13-inch baking dish.
- Cook the gnocchiย according to package instructions, then drain and set aside.
- Make the sauce: In a large skillet, heat olive oil and butter over medium heat. Add minced garlic and sautรฉ for 1 minute until fragrant.
- Add the cream and milk: Stir in the heavy cream and whole milk, bringing the mixture to a simmer.
- Melt the cheese: Add mozzarella, Parmesan, salt, pepper, Italian seasoning, and red pepper flakes. Stir until the cheese is melted and the sauce is smooth.
- Combine: Add the cooked gnocchi to the sauce, tossing to coat evenly. If using bacon or spinach, stir them in now.
- Transfer to baking dish: Pour the mixture into the greased baking dish and spread evenly.
- Bake: Bake uncovered for 20 minutes, or until the sauce is bubbling and the top is lightly golden.
- Garnish and serve: Remove from the oven, sprinkle with fresh basil, and let it cool slightly before serving.
Notes
- For extra cheesiness, sprinkle an additional ยฝ cup of mozzarella on top before baking.
- You can use store-bought or homemade gnocchi.
- Add cooked chicken or Italian sausage for extra protein.
- Store leftovers in an airtight container in the fridge for up to 3 days. Reheat in the oven or microwave.
